Between 2008 and 2012, TV services in the UK will go completely digital, region by region. The UK’s old analogue television signal is being switched off and replaced with a digital signal. This will create a fairer situation in which everyone has access to a choice of affordable digital services.

Digital UK is the independent body set up by the broadcasters to implement digital switchover in the UK. The company is owned and funded by the public-service broadcasters and multiplex operators.

Digital UK:

  • explains switchover to the public through a £200m, seven-year communications programme
  • manages the upgrading of the UK’s 1,154 TV transmitters
  • works with industry to ensure understanding and support for the switchover project
